Display math in TeX with KaTeX and ReactJS

import React, { useMemo } from 'react';
import PropTypes from 'prop-types';
import KaTeX from 'katex';
/**
* @typedef {import("react").ReactNode} ReactNode
*
*
* @callback ErrorRenderer
* @param {Error} error
* @returns {ReactNode}
*
*
* @typedef {object} MathComponentPropsWithMath
* @property {string} math
* @property {ReactNode=} children
* @property {string=} errorColor
* @property {ErrorRenderer=} renderError
*
*
* @typedef {object} MathComponentPropsWithChildren
* @property {string=} math
* @property {ReactNode} children
* @property {string=} errorColor
* @property {ErrorRenderer=} renderError
*
* @typedef {MathComponentPropsWithMath | MathComponentPropsWithChildren} MathComponentProps
*/
const createMathComponent = (Component, { displayMode }) => {
/**
*
* @param {MathComponentProps} props
* @returns {ReactNode}
*/
const MathComponent = ({ children, errorColor, math, renderError }) => {
const formula = math ?? children;
const { html, error } = useMemo(() => {
try {
const html = KaTeX.renderToString(formula, {
displayMode,
errorColor,
throwOnError: !!renderError,
});
return { html, error: undefined };
} catch (error) {
if (error instanceof KaTeX.ParseError || error instanceof TypeError) {
return { error };
}
throw error;
}
}, [formula, errorColor, renderError]);
if (error) {
return renderError ? renderError(error) : <Component html={`${error.message}`} />;
}
return <Component html={html} />;
};
MathComponent.propTypes = {
children: PropTypes.string,
errorColor: PropTypes.string,
math: PropTypes.string,
renderError: PropTypes.func,
};
return MathComponent;
};
const InternalPathComponentPropTypes = {
html: PropTypes.string.isRequired,
};
const InternalBlockMath = ({ html }) => {
return <div data-testid="react-katex" dangerouslySetInnerHTML={{ __html: html }} />;
};
InternalBlockMath.propTypes = InternalPathComponentPropTypes;
const InternalInlineMath = ({ html }) => {
return <span data-testid="react-katex" dangerouslySetInnerHTML={{ __html: html }} />;
};
InternalInlineMath.propTypes = InternalPathComponentPropTypes;
export const BlockMath = createMathComponent(InternalBlockMath, { displayMode: true });
export const InlineMath = createMathComponent(InternalInlineMath, { displayMode: false });
